Livy's works have had a profound impact on the way we approach historical writing today. His emphasis on a narrative style added a level of excitement and engagement that many modern historians still strive to achieve. When I first stumbled upon 'The Early History of Rome,' I was struck by how Livy not only documented events but also infused his accounts with moral lessons and character analyses. This approach allows readers to connect with history on a much deeper level. It’s fascinating to see how contemporary writers borrow this technique, blending rigorous research with storytelling to transform dry facts into compelling narratives. Livy’s ability to humanize history, portraying it as the result of individual choices and societal dynamics, reminds us that history isn’t just a series of dates and events. His reflections on moral questions still resonate today—take, for instance, the discussions around virtue, leadership, and the fallibility of human nature. These themes are just as relevant now, with modern historians often weaving these philosophical inquiries into their analyses. It might even be said that Livy's influence extends beyond historical writing into fields like political science and ethics, where the lessons of the past inform present-day dilemmas. The conversations his works spark between scholars and general readers alike are incredibly rich, making Livy a cornerstone in the development of historical narrative. It's a delightful challenge to trace his influence through the offerings of contemporary authors, who work hard to capture the same blend of excitement and depth that he achieved centuries ago. Livy’s legacy continues to shape how we understand and present our own histories, mixing facts with the human experience in a way that is both engaging and enlightening.

I've been chewing on this question a lot while rereading stuff late at night, and for me the authors who tackle depravity most effectively are the ones who don't just show gross things, they make you live inside the moral rot. If you want slow, corrosive psychological breakdowns, start with Shuzo Oshimi — 'The Flowers of Evil' and 'Inside Mari' dig into teenage transgression and the way shame metastasizes. Oshimi nails that uncomfortable feeling of watching someone slip and knowing you could be next; the panels feel claustrophobic, like a camera that won't cut away. For a more visceral, body-horror route, Junji Ito remains unmatched. Works like 'Uzumaki' and the many shorter tales force depravity into surreal, physical forms, turning neighborhood anxieties into something grotesque. Hideo Yamamoto's 'Homunculus' is another one that lingers in your head: it mixes psychosis, voyeurism, and social outcasts in a way that makes you question whether the depravity is external or a mirror of the protagonist's mind. If you're curious about modern internet-age cruelty, 'Dead Tube' is brutal about performative violence and online spectacle, while 'I Am a Hero' flips the depravity into societal collapse and how ordinary people reveal their worst impulses under pressure. Can Historical Romance Novels Authors Switch To Contemporary?

4 Answers2025-08-20 03:43:18
As someone who has dabbled in both reading and writing historical and contemporary romance, I believe the transition is not only possible but can be incredibly rewarding. Historical romance authors often have a knack for meticulous research and world-building, skills that translate beautifully into contemporary settings. For instance, Julia Quinn, known for 'Bridgerton', could easily adapt her sharp dialogue and character dynamics to a modern-day rom-com. The key lies in retaining the emotional depth and intricate relationships that define historical romance while embracing the freedoms and nuances of contemporary storytelling. That said, the shift isn't without challenges. Historical romance often relies on societal constraints to create tension, whereas contemporary romance thrives on personal and internal conflicts. Authors like Lisa Kleypas, who successfully ventured into contemporary with 'Sugar Daddy', prove it’s doable. The trick is to study the pacing and tone of modern romance—think Emily Henry’s banter or Sally Rooney’s introspection—and blend it with the author’s signature style. Ultimately, it’s about evolving without losing the essence of what makes their storytelling unique.
